Fastener Material Selection

There is no one fastener material that is right for every environment. Selecting the right fastener material from the vast array of materials available can appear to be a daunting task. Careful consideration needs to be given to strength, temperature, corrosion, vibration, fatigue and many other variables. However, with some basic knowledge and understanding, a well thought out evaluation can be made.

Grades & Sizes

Metric Fasteners come in many grades & sizes. Fastener Grade (US) or Class (metric) refers to the mechanical properties of the fastener material. Generally, a higher number indicates a stronger, more hardened (but also more brittle) fastener. Our handy charts can help you find the metric fastener you need for your application.

Tensile Strength

The most widely associated mechanical property associated with standard threaded fasteners is tensile strength. Tensile strength is the maximum tension-applied load the fastener can support prior to its fracture. This table below looks at Tensile Strength of Fasteners by Class. The higher the class, the higher the tensile strength.
